the total iron closs in a transformer core at normal flux density was measured at 25hz and 5ohz and was found to be 250w and 800w respectively.the hysteresis loss at 50hz would be................?????
Answer / utkarsh agarwal
according to the data flux density is constant.
Pe1=f1^2 Ph1=f1
Pe2=f2^2 Ph2=f2
takinf f1=25hz
f2=50 hz
Pe1/Pe2=1/4
Ph1/Ph2=1/2
now iron loss Pi=Ph1+Pe1
Therefoe
1. ph1 + pe1=250
2. 2ph1+ 4pe1=800
solving we get ph2= 200w
P.S. : "=" is meant to be proportiaonality sign in first 3 lines
